- Organic ingredients are mainly used, with a focus on pesticide-free produce. - Ingredients are sourced mainly from Kyushu. - No genetically modified or additive-containing ingredients are used. - Ingredients containing trans fats generated by hydrogenation are not used. - Sweeteners such as mirin, brown sugar, fruits, and honey are used. - No white sugar is used. [Vegetable-focused Japanese Meal] Main Dish (Burdock and Tofu Shin Da Maki) 4 Side Dishes Seasonal Vegetable Salad Brown Rice Miso Soup [Low-Sugar Sweets] New Item (Fig and Pesticide-Free Lemon Cake) Topped with lemon cream and kibidango-cooked fresh figs, with a refreshing lemon-infused chocolate topping that enhances the overall flavor. The meal was delicious, but the low-sugar cake was especially tasty! I will definitely visit again. - Values at Veggie Salad Dining - Our daily meals shape our bodies. By changing our diet, we can transform our bodies and minds, and even our values and way of life. Have you ever considered paying a little more attention to the food you eat every day? Prioritizing convenience in our diet can harm our bodies, minds, and the environment we live in. Cherishing our daily meals is the foundation of Veggie Salad Dining. We carefully select seasonal ingredients and handcraft our meals. Our goal is not only to serve delicious food but also to inspire an interest in the importance of daily meals and the environment surrounding them. This is why we stand in the kitchen, hoping to share the joy of eating delicious food and raising awareness about the significance of our daily meals and their impact on the environment.

Located in a small alley across from Chikushi Jogakuen in Chuo Ward, this restaurant has a natural feel with a white and wood-based interior. With only 3 tables, it's recommended to make a reservation if you're going with more than one person. The menu consists of two types of set meals, one focusing on vegetables and the other on meat, which change weekly. There are also desserts and drinks available for those looking to enjoy a cafe experience. The meat main set meal costs 1300 yen and comes with a variety of vegetable side dishes, including a chicken and vegetable stir-fry made with high-quality chicken. The rice is mixed grain, but may not be enough for those with a big appetite. The owners, possibly a couple, were friendly, though the female owner seemed a bit off. They also offer takeout for bento boxes and drinks. Overall, the sweets looked delicious as well.

I walk from the Sakurazaka Subway Station to the restaurant. It's a trendy area with a sophisticated atmosphere. As I enter the alley, I arrive at the restaurant. It has a simple white-walled exterior. During lunchtime, I greet the staff for the first time. There are a few counter seats and tables inside. The interior is as simple as the exterior. The main dish on the rice menu is labeled as "Japanese rice with vegetables." There are two main dishes that change weekly. Today's menu is written on a blackboard, and the staff kindly explained it to me. One is a vegetarian dish with pumpkin croquettes as the main dish. The other is a fish dish. Both come with the same side dishes. I'll have the croquettes, please. While waiting, I visited the restroom. There was a small flower arrangement inside. This attention to detail. I can feel the owner's thoughtful care in every corner of the restaurant space (although I didn't check every corner, I could sense it somehow). The rice set arrives = in addition to the main dish, there are four side dishes, salad, rice, and miso soup. It's a generous portion! Let's dig in. There are three side dishes in one small bowl. Among them, the thick hijiki seaweed is delicious. The bitter melon and carrot salad gives off a sense of meticulousness in how the carrots are cut. The miso soup is served in a bowl that is easy to hold and has a pleasant texture. The okra pieces floating in the center of the bowl make it look like, huh? Was the miso soup poured like this on purpose? Oh, what a wonderful attention to detail! The croquette main dish is soft with mashed pumpkin inside and crispy coating. Personally, one croquette is enough for me, but I don't want to leave any food on the plate. I asked for a small portion of rice, but it's still a lot... Hmm, I finished it all! The fried food feels heavy in my stomach, but I feel refreshed. This attention to detail. I learned about the owner's dedication to cooking by looking at the restaurant's website later. Even without reading this, I could tell from the restaurant's ambiance and the dishes I received. The attitude of the cook is reflected in the food, as I realized once again. This is a meal that satisfies not only the stomach but also the heart ♥ Besides the rice, they also have low-sugar sweets. They must be delicious. I'll definitely try them next time! Thank you for the meal ☆

From the direction of Daimyo, I went on the Kokutai-dori towards Keyaki Street, turned right at the intersection of Akasaka 2-chome towards Sakurazaka Station, and went down Hanamizuki Street. The restaurant was located in a hard-to-find spot between a beauty salon and a parking lot with signs. It was a trendy cafe-style place with about 15 seats, including a counter with about 5 seats, making it easy for even solo diners to enter. We chose set meals A and B, and decided on the meal by choosing whether to add dessert and a drink. My friend chose B, so I went with A. That day's set meal A was deep-fried tofu and simmered daikon, with a side of taro and lotus root stew, daikon and carrot vinegar dish, spinach salad, miso soup, and healthy rice. I'm not a fan of deep-fried tofu, but I didn't want to be seen as a man with no taste by choosing the same set meal as the woman who ordered first, so I reluctantly chose A. However, this choice turned out to be the right one. The deep-fried tofu was cooked in a way that eliminated its dryness and unique texture that I dislike, and it was surprisingly delicious. The salad with frilly lettuce and citrus dressing had a crispy texture and a refreshing acidity. The dessert, a low-chocolate tart, was not too sweet and easy for even men to enjoy with the persimmon sauce. Overall, the set meal, which used a variety of vegetables and was lightly seasoned, including the dessert, provided a "kind and rich meal experience," which I found to be human-like and somewhat luxurious.
